Specialty logic encompasses a diverse range of integrated circuits designed to perform specific logic functions beyond basic gate operations. These include arithmetic logic units (ALUs), shift registers, counters, and state machines tailored to meet the unique requirements of specific applications. Specialty logic devices are widely used in digital signal processing, data encryption, motor control, and other specialized tasks where standard logic gates alone are insufficient to meet performance or functionality demands.
